TEN REASONS TO BECOME A MASON

9/12/2013

 
 1. Masonry is a place where you can confidently trust every person, and entrust your family with them.

2. Masonry is a place where, within moral and civil guidelines; free thought, free speaking and the spiritual growth of man can grow into its fullest potential.

3. Masonry is a place which provides the opportunity to meet, know, and call brother, outstanding individuals from all walks of life that I would not otherwise have met.

4. Masonry is a place to be a part of an organization that has for its principle tenets ---Brotherly Love, Relief, and Truth.

5. Masonry is a place that provides self-development opportunities, leadership training and experience, and to improve public
speaking skills.

6. Masonry is a place you can go to give support as well as seek it.

7. Masonry is a place where moral virtues are taught and through these teachings a regular reinforcement of the moral virtues is experienced.

8. Masonry is a place to spend time with a group of brothers, who, by acting as good men, make me want to become a better man. Not better than others, but better than I would otherwise have been.

9. Masonry is a place to become better prepared to serve the community.

10. Masonry is a place to meet with established members of the community and to become a part of the community.

Fall Food Drive for Eden Community Food Bank

9/7/2013

 
Picture


Bro. Furlong is coordinating a Fall Food Drive for the Lodge. Donations of non-perishable food items and/or money will be given to the Eden Community Food Bank at Eden United Church to assist with the hardships families and individuals face during the Thanksgiving and Christmas seasons.

Please bring in your donations to the lodge.  Collection of donations will continue through the months of September, October and November.  You can bring them to our General Purposes and Regular Lodge meetings. 

Items needed include:

  • Holiday Basket stuffers- mashed potatoes, stuffing mix, cranberry sauce, gravy, canned vegetables
  • Tuna, Salmon
  • Canned Meats – chicken, ham, luncheon meat
  • Juice
  • Baked Beans
  • Condensed Soup (no tomato please)
  • Cold Cereal
  • Granola bars
  • Nut Free Snacks
  • Canned Fruit
  • Side Dishes
  • Cookies
  • White Flour
  • Baking items (cake, cookie and muffin mixes)
  • Shampoo, Deodorant, Body Wash, Toothpaste
  • Feminine Pads
  • Hot Chocolate
  • Depends – Women’s ( M) , Men’s ( L)
